Things don’t necessarily even out. I’d like to see the Dodgers’ splits over that time to see how it played out (yes, I’m too lazy to look). Two bad months and four normal months can make things look bad, yet only the two bad months are an unexpected outcome. After a bad/good stretch, the expected outcome is not the opposite; the expected outcome is normality.- 60 replies

Hitting with RISP isn’t a “problem” anymore than having a bad BaseRuns or Pythag record is a “problem” six weeks into a season. Teams run into bouts of bad luck in a variety of ways. The Twins happen to be neutral in both Pythag and BaseRuns but are “unlucky” with RISP. So are they neutral or unlucky? It doesn’t matter. The games have been played. Past performance does not guarantee future results.- 60 replies

It’s probably time to admit we were wrong, the front office was right. This isn’t luck, this is change of approach. He’s throwing his fastball 2mph faster, basically ditched the slider, and added a cutter. Perez is a different guy now. He’s likely not THIS good but he could be quite good going forward. On top of helping fix Perez, this front office deserves extra kudos for having such faith in their ability to improve him that they added a second option year to the deal.
